What if your dataset is larger than your computer's memory?

That's exactly the problem Python generators were designed to solve.

In this video, you'll learn how generators work, why the yield keyword is so powerful, and how modern backend systems and AI applications process massive datasets without loading everything into memory.

Topics Covered:

• The large dataset problem
• Why loading everything into memory doesn't scale
• What generators are
• yield vs return
• Generator objects
• Lazy evaluation
• next() explained
• State preservation
• StopIteration
• Real-world backend applications
• AI and Machine Learning use cases

By the end of this lesson, you'll understand one of the most important concepts in modern Python development and why generators are heavily used in backend engineering, data processing, and machine learning pipelines.
